In the hosting world, a control panel is a web-based instrument which can help you to control your hosting account through a graphic interface using various tools. Since the alternative is to type in commands in a command line, many people prefer to use a control panel to control their website content. There are many control panel types and the ease of administration through each one is different, but the vast majority of tools supply a basic set of services which you can manage using a point-and-click interface. For instance working with files and folders, managing email addresses and databases or viewing access and error logs. Several control panels will enable you to do a lot more things too, so when you buy a web hosting plan, you should check the advantages and disadvantages of the software tool that you will use to manage your new account.
